Sitters on Rover are free to set their rates. The median cost to hire a sitter for doggy day care in Shorewood on Rover as of Feb 2026 was about $35 per day, after factoring in Roverâs service fees. A sitterâs rate may also change as you customize your booking to fit your and your dogâs needs.
As of Feb 2026, 508 sitters provided doggy day care in Shorewood. You can filter, sort, expand your radius, read reviews, and compare pricing to find the perfect sitter near you. As a reminder, sitters offering doggy day care joining Rover must pass a background check for you and your dogâs safety.
Rover makes it easy to reach out to multiple sitters about your booking. Typically, 90% of Shorewood sitters offering doggy day care respond in under an hour.
Sitters who provide doggy day care in Shorewood have an average of 20 years of experience. Sitters offering doggy day care with repeat customers have an average of 4 repeat clients. Experience can vary from sitter to sitter, but you can view reviews, years of experience, and number of repeat clients when you compare sitters in Shorewood.
Shorewood doggy day care sitters are happy to take care of your dog while youâre at work or unavailable for the day. Book a one-time visit, or set up a regular rhythm with your favorite Shorewood sitter. Drop off your dog at the sitterâs home and rest easy knowing theyâll get frequent potty breaks, plenty of playtime, and lots of love. Doggy day care is great for:
- Puppies and high-energy dogs
- Dogs with special needs, including seniors
- Pet parents who work long hours
- Dogs with separation anxiety
